Laser Source

Receiver

Keysight N4375D Lightwave Component Analyzer, User's Guide
The Tools tab always showing the current settings of the
instrument. These may be different to what is selected on
the other tabs.
Source Wavelength (nm)
Set the wavelength of the laser source.
Power [dBm]
Set the optical output power of the laser source.
Laser On
• Select to turn the laser source on.
• Deselect to turn the laser source off.
External Input
The External Input is an optional extra for the Lightwave
Component Analyzer.
• Select to use a laser source connected to the External
Input on the rear of the optical test set.
• Deselect to use the the laser source in the optical test set.
Optimize ModBias
Start an immediate bias optimization for the modulator.
Optical Input
Select the input to which your device under test is
connected.
• For input signals up to +7 dBm (calibrated up to
+5 dBm), use Input 1.
• For input signals up to +17 dBm (calibrated up to
+15 dBm), use Input 2.
Receiver Wavelength (nm)
Set the wavelength of to be used by the optical power meter.
